
OMERS Ventures
Description
OMERS Ventures is the venture capital arm of OMERS, one of Canada's largest defined benefit pension plans, managing over CAD 128 billion in net assets as of December 31, 2023. Established in 2011, the firm is headquartered in Toronto, with additional offices in Palo Alto and New York, strategically positioning itself across key North American innovation hubs. It focuses on early-stage, high-growth technology companies, leveraging the substantial financial backing and long-term perspective of its parent organization.
The firm's investment thesis centers on disruptive technologies and business models across various sectors. OMERS Ventures actively seeks opportunities in areas such as SaaS, FinTech, Digital Health, Artificial Intelligence/Machine Learning, Cybersecurity, and the Future of Work. While originating from Canada, its investment mandate extends across North America and Europe, demonstrating a broad geographic appetite for promising startups. The team emphasizes a hands-on approach, providing portfolio companies with strategic guidance, operational support, and access to a vast network.
OMERS Ventures has built a robust portfolio through significant capital commitments. The firm announced its fifth fund, Fund V, in November 2023, with a committed capital of $250 million dedicated to early-stage tech investments. This latest fund contributes to their impressive total of over $2 billion in committed capital across all five funds since their inception. Typically, OMERS Ventures deploys first cheques ranging from $5 million to $20 million, primarily targeting Series A and Series B rounds, though they also participate in Seed and later-stage opportunities depending on the strategic fit and potential for scale.
Investor Profile
OMERS Ventures has backed more than 125 startups, with 8 new investments in the last 12 months alone. The firm has led 59 rounds, about 47% of its total and boasts 19 exits across its portfolio.
Investment Focus Highlights
- Concentrates on Series A, Series B, Series C rounds (top funding stages).
- Majority of deals are located in Canada, United States, United Kingdom.
- Strong thematic focus on Software, SaaS, Financial Services.
- Typical check size: $5M – $20M.
Stage Focus
- Series A (28%)
- Series B (23%)
- Series C (18%)
- Seed (10%)
- Series D (8%)
- Series Unknown (7%)
- Series E (2%)
- Secondary Market (2%)
- Series F (1%)
- Corporate Round (1%)
Country Focus
- Canada (46%)
- United States (28%)
- United Kingdom (10%)
- Germany (8%)
- Sweden (2%)
- Belgium (2%)
- Ireland (2%)
- The Netherlands (2%)
Industry Focus
- Software
- Saas
- Financial Services
- Fintech
- Apps
- Enterprise Software
- Big Data
- Information Technology
- Cloud Computing
- Health Care
Frequently Asked Questions
Learn who this investor regularly partners with—both firms and angels—and explore their latest activity.